Colombia National Football Team took on Guatemala National Football Team in a friendly match on September 24. Colombia emerged victorious with a 4-1 win.

On the 40th minute, James Rodriguez netted the first goal of the match, tipping the balance in Colombia's favor. goals from Luis Sinisterra, Rafael Borre, Yaser Asprilla and Oscar Santis followed, bringing the match to a 4-1 conclusion.

Recent Form

Colombia are on a three-game winning streak, with victories against Saudi Arabia, Venezuela and Bolivia in their last three matches, while Guatemala’s previous game resulted in a win against Dominican Republic.. Overall, over their most recent twenty games, Colombia have claimed seven victories, suffered six defeats, and drawn seven times, while in their last nineteen matches, Guatemala have recorded eight wins, three losses, and eight draws.
